In some cases transferring an all-digital project to analog tape can smooth out the top end and add a little warmth to the overall sound. For this process I use an Ampex ATR-102 ˝” tape recorder running at 15 or 30ips. The ATR-102 has been the two-track of choice in professional recording studios for 30 years.

A DDP file set is an error–protected wrapper format specifically designed for reliable optical disc replication. DDP or “Disc Description Protocol” is the industry standard method for delivering all of the data and metadata needed for disc replication to a “pressing plant.” Unlike audio CDs, DDP file sets contain error–protected audio data plus all ancillary metadata or, “data about the data.” If your replication company can’t accept a DDP as the master or if you have ordered CD-TEXT I will provide you with a PMCD master.
